Design, Construction And Implementation Of Temperature Control In Vapor-Liquid Equilibrium Cell (VLE)

DCMG Bravo_Sanchez, MCJJ Martinez_Nolasco, JA Ramírez_Montañez

This article talks about the design and implementation of a thermal control in vapor-liquid equilibrium cell (VLE). Including integration of an amplifier circuit instrumentation for sensing stage by a thermocouple in conjunction with a full wave rectifier controlled. This controller used as a single-phase power line AC voltage which will be rectified to supply the voltage used by a thermal blanket and this transform electrical to thermal energy. The temperature generated by the heater blanket will depend on the way to generate this contact with the surface to be heated and the insulation used. The display operation of the control signals will be on a computer with the LabVIEW platform using an Arduino UNO which function as a data acquisition card. EVL cells are important in obtaining thermodynamic properties.
